Air Space Requirements

Considering air space requirements when choosing a BandPass subwoofer box is essential for optimal audio performance. The proper amount of air space can significantly impact the efficiency and sound quality of the subwoofer. Inadequate air space can lead to distortion and reduced bass output, while excessive air space can lead to loss of control and damping. Ensuring the correct air space requirements will result in a well-balanced and powerful sound system.

How Does A Bandpass Subwoofer Box Differ From Other Types Of Subwoofer Boxes?

A bandpass subwoofer box is designed with a specific resonance frequency range to exploit the sound produced by the subwoofer driver. It differs from other types of subwoofer boxes by efficiently directing and amplifying lower frequency sound waves, resulting in increased bass output. The box’s construction and design allow only a narrow band of frequencies to pass through, providing a more focused and powerful bass experience.

What Are The Advantages Of Using A Bandpass Subwoofer Box?

A bandpass subwoofer box offers advantages such as increased efficiency, better power handling, and enhanced bass response. The enclosure design often allows for a narrower frequency band to be reproduced, resulting in tighter, more impactful bass output. Additionally, bandpass enclosures can provide greater acoustic gain and reduced distortion compared to other types of subwoofer boxes.
